About The Position

The Critical Environment Manager is key to all processes and procedures required to maintain and operate a Data Center in the most effective and efficient way possible. The CEM will support the global alignment of the company by developing processes and procedures, providing training, auditing correct usage and identifying and implement improvements (continuous improvement cycle).

Responsibilities

  • The Critical Environments team serves as the owner and developer of Global Operations Playbook
  • Assess Campus Leadership to align Global Operations Playbook to local and customer requirements by creating site specific processes.
  • Assist Campus Operations Manager and commercial Director in development of other processes which are of a commercial nature which will include Security access and procedure model and implementations of SLA agreements for the purpose of Yondr Client, and Yondr FM service provider
  • Assist Data Center Service Delivery Manager in development of Logistics processes
  • Manage Root Cause process
  • Promote “lessons learned” approach, ensuring all information for future use is readily and easily accessible to key stakeholders and is being utilized to improve and innovate
  • Development of Audit scope and schedule for internal Data Center Operations team. Audit will cover all critical processes essential for the continued successful operation of the Data Center
  • Conduct routine site visits and audit sites and site Vendors.
  • Development and implementation of Critical Environment Training
  • Main point of contact for CAFM development
  • Responsible for compliance of Procedures and ensuring innovation is considered for continuous improvement
  • Maintain understanding of the changing Data Center market through researching new technologies and innovations.
  • With the assistance of the Technology department, ensure energy management is operated at best efficiency, and in scope with all in country requirements.
